Re: Looking to go shooting in far west valley
On my soap box once again!! Joe Foss Shooting complex is inside the Buckeye Hills Recreation Area. SR-85 south towards Gila Bend to mile marker 144. Re: 16 gauge ammo
I use a Sweet 16 for duck and geese. If you think it is hard to find regular shells, try to find steel shot. It's a little tough, but Mac's Prairie Wing in Stutgart Ark always has a sufficient stock. Lead and smaller size shot. Mail order, too.
